homephotosDelhi Celebrates National Cultural Festival
Delhi Celebrates National Cultural Festival
The vibrant National Cultural Festival or Rashtriya Sanskriti Mahotsav in New Delhi celebrates the diversity of India. The festival aims to popularise India's heritage and culture.